#31061: Aug 8th 2018 at 4:59:25 PM

Because it means they had time to set DBZA and its associated stress aside, work out their schedule and how they may incorporate DBZA into it in the future, release some of the deadline frustration they've been wrestling for years, etc.

Sometimes, with any given creative project, you just hit burnout. Kaiser says that if they had never gone ahead with this hiatus and had forced themselves to finish the season right then and there, they would without question call this the final episode and walk away. That was the stress level they were at with trying to prioritize it above everything else.

This was a much-needed break to retool their business model, figure out the logistics of starting some actual for-profit work like their new official anime dub, and then decide where DBZA will fit into that model. Rather than rushing out a final product and then declaring that it doesn't.
